| Blazers Take Series |
| Valdosta State blanks Diamond Jags, 12-0 |
| Web Posted 2/17/08 |
AUGUSTA,
Ga. --
Valdosta State shut out Augusta State 12-0 Sunday
afternoon in the final game of a three-game series at Lake Olmstead
Stadium.
The Blazers (5-3-1) pounded out 16 hits off of four Jaguar pitchers. ASU freshman Patrick Lowe took the loss, falling to 1-1 on the season. He surrendered four hits and five runs in 2.2 innings.
Jeremy Forbus went seven innings for VSU to earn the win, giving up the only three hits by the Jags. He struck out six and walked two. Will Thompson allowed two hits and struck out four in the final two innings.
A two-run double by the Blazers' Shawn Keill sparked a five-run rally in the third inning. They plated two runs in the fifth and sixth innings and closed out the game in the ninth with another three runs.
The Jags return to action Tuesday, Feb. 19, when they host Anderson in a non-conference matchup. The first pitch is set for 2:00 p.m. at Jaguar Field adjacent to Christenberry Fieldhouse.
